Shahpur Population - Bareilly, Uttar Pradesh

Shahpur is a small village located in Meerganj Tehsil of Bareilly district, Uttar Pradesh with total 36 families residing. The Shahpur village has population of 187 of which 92 are males while 95 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Shahp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 20 which makes up 10.70 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Shahpur village is 1033 which is higher than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Shahpur as per census is 1222, higher than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Shahpur village has higher liter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Shahpur village was 74.25 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Shahpur Male literacy stands at 87.95 % while female literacy rate was 60.71 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 1.60 % of total population in Shahpur village. The village Shahpur curr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Shahpur village out of total population, 45 were engaged in work activities. 73.33 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 26.67 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 45 workers engaged in Main Work, 20 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 7 were Agricultural labourer.
